Surefire Resources NL (SRN) — Net Asset Quality Index
Surefire Resources NL (SRN) has a Net Asset Quality Index of 30.7% as of December 2025. This metric measures the proportion of total assets financed by shareholders' equity — total assets of AU$13.73 Million minus total liabilities of AU$9.51 Million yields net assets of AU$4.22 Million. A higher index indicates a stronger, lower-leverage balance sheet. See SRN cash and liquid assets coverage to measure how many days the company can operate on defensive assets alone.
